They’re rich in soluble fiber and immune-supporting vitamin … Web2 days ago · While some dairy products, such as milk and butter, were slightly cheaper in the US, grocery shopping at Aldi in the UK proved much less expensive. Excluding tax, our UK grocery trip would have totaled £21.48, or $25.83, while in the US, we would have spent $38.40 (£31.91) for the items.

WebYou can buy cheap fruit, vegetables, meat, pastas, sauces, and spices. Generally the price is $0.999 (so figure a buck each). A pound or two of pasta? $1. A bag of carrots? $1. Lemons, limes, oranges, blueberries, strawberries, even cherries: $1 - $2/pound. Breakfasts are easy: oatmeal and cold cereal are $1/box. Milk is $1 per quart.
